Output 183776a5e745553850a8083b123c30eb935f28c37ef4fa3d72e3cb65cb8e383b:25

value
1387240000
script pubkey
OP_0 OP_PUSHBYTES_20 23caebdf500ed3317bbdfe6c1e1e6b28cb46b1b6
address
ltc1qy09whh6spmfnz7aalekpu8nt9r95dvdk9rh2r2
transaction
183776a5e745553850a8083b123c30eb935f28c37ef4fa3d72e3cb65cb8e383b
spent
true